Appeal launched following shoplifting incident in Emsworth

Police are appealing for information following a shoplifting incident at a store in Emsworth

 

At approximately 12.15pm on Sunday 15 May two men entered Harbour Records in Harbour Court on Emsworth High Street and left with several vinyl records without attempting to make payment.

 

Officers investigating the incident now have these images of two men, seen in the area at the time, who we would like to speak to in connection with this incident.

 

The first man is described as:

 

White

 

Aged between 60 and 70-years-old

 

Approximately 6ft tall

 

Balding, with thinning short hair

 

Wearing dark clothing.

 

The second man is described as:

White

 

Aged between 60 and 70-years-old

 

Approximately 5ft 6in to 5ft 8in tall

 

Short, thinning, receding grey hair

 

Wearing glasses.

 

Police would like to hear from anyone who recognises the men pictured or anyone who has information that may assist their enquiries.
